Latest Patents
Hacker holds 1 patent for his invention titled "High velocity oxygen fuel (HVOF) liquid fuel gun and burner design." This invention provides a burner design and method for a high velocity oxygen fuel (HVOF) liquid fuel gun that generates turbulent atomization. It utilizes one or more jets as an injection method for liquid fuel and oxygen to enhance combustion within the combustion chamber. The burner employs preheated oxygen and preheated fuel to improve vaporization prior to combustion.
